DetailsFroth Flotation Method:This method is mainly used to remove gangue from sulphide ores.The ore is powdered and a suspension is created in water. To this are added, Collectors and Froth Stabilizers. Collectors (pine oils, fatty acids etc) increase the non-wettability of the metal part of the ore and allows it to form a froth.
DetailsThe purpose of the primary crusher is to reduce the ROM ore to a size amenable for feeding the secondary crusher or the SAG mill grinding circuit. The ratio of reduction through a primary crusher can be up to about 8:1. Feed: ROM up to 1.5 m; Product: -300mm (for transport) to -200mm (for SAG mill) Feed Rate: 160 to 13,000 tph

DetailsSulphide copper ores are normally concentrated by flotation while the oxide ores undergo hydrometallurgical treatments. The mixed sulphide-oxide copper ores may be processed by combined methods such as flotation followed by leaching and precipitation of the oxidized portion, or vice-versa. DetailsThe jaw crusher will handle rock and ore containing a considerable proportion of loam, or similar contamination, provided that the admixture is not so viscous that it builds up on the jaw plates. The gyratory should never be used for materials containing more than a small percentage of such contamination, the allowable amount …
